Common Name Henderson's Dyakia [English Nurseryman 1800's]

Flower Size 1" [3cm]

This species was previously known as Ascocentrum hendersonianum. It is found in Borneo and is a hot growing, minature epiphyte at elevation saround 800 meters in riverine, seasonally swampy forest with a short stem carrying, ligulate to oblanceolate, unequally, obtusely bilobed apically leaves that blooms in the spring and summer on an erect, to 6" [15 cm] long, densly many [to 40] flowered inflorescence with broadly ovate bracts with showy, fragrant flowers.

Synonyms Ascocentrum hendersonianium [Rchb.f.] Schlechter 1914; *Saccolabium hendersonianum Rchb.f 1875
